Cancelled Protest: Why Ordinary Nigerians Should Lead by Naijiant: 4:09pm On Feb 05, 2017
The 2Face climb down has highlighted the dangers of movements led from the top. Bob Marley sang in "Zimbabwe": "So soon we'll find out who is the real revolutionary and I don't want my people to be tricked by mercenaries." While it is not clear whether 2Face's attempts to lead a protest were motivated by mercenary reasons, it is absolutely clear that he is no revolutionary.

When it came to the crunch, a very rich singer, not surprisingly, decided he could not afford to cast his lot with long-suffering Nigerians and march against misrule. It clearly shows why ordinary Nigerians have to organise themselves and not look to the rich and famous for "heroes".
